It was a huge undertaking.
Not necessarily far, but the idea of a meeting of all the pack leaders in the area seemed… Suspicious. She couldn’t help but think that maybe this was somehow a trick, or perhaps some awful war tactic. Get them all in one place and then strike. Would be a terribly easy thing to do, especially for what seemed like endless numbers of those beasts. They’d be little more than rabbits to them.
Tailing them to the border through the rugged mountainous terrain, Faolan’s eyes lingered on the gangly female in front of her. It was a strange thing, suddenly realizing that this wolf she’d been so irritated with for months was now one of her biggest sources of solace.
She had friends - she’d been proven that over the course of the last two moons. After what had happened, it seemed like those she was closest to were eager to remind her that she was wanted and needed here in Mhor, despite the actions of a few. Her blue gaze drifted over to the silver and black retreating form with a frown, ripping it away just as fast.
Maybe it was the strange predicament they found themselves, having forged some peculiar bond around their shared trauma and needs, but while she had other strong friendships, there was a particular comfort she took in Rowena now. Like it or not, they leaned on each other. And maybe that wasn’t so bad.
Regardless of the reason, when Reiwen stopped them at the border for a brief moment, Faolan padded up to her companion, Rowena turning around to face her.
Their words were fairly concise - meaningless, maybe - but as they crossed over the boundary of Mhor territory, she could only watch them go, ears tipped back.
What if something happened? That was their leader (and her sister, but that wasn’t in the forefront of her mind) and it wasn’t like they had a backup plan if this went south. Who knew what the others packs intentions were?
The storm in her heart continued, and she sat down in the snow, stopping to think for hours after the three had disappeared from view.
For what felt like the millionth time in the last few seasons, Faolan could only think; Was this the right decision?
